How do I bulk delete emails on my iPad?

How to delete multiple email messages

  1. Open Mail and go to your Inbox.
  2. Tap Edit in the upper-right corner, then individually select the emails that you want to delete, or tap Select All.
  3. Tap Trash or Archive. If you only see Archive, touch and hold Archive to see other options like Trash Selected Messages.

Why don’t my emails delete from my iPad when I delete them from my iPhone?

It needs to be configured as IMAP. Go to Settings/Passwords & Accounts on each device and tap on the account name. If it says it is a POP account delete it, then add it back and it should default to IMAP. Thank you, this worked for me.

Do you have to have iOS 9 to delete all mail?

To have the Delete All feature, you’ll need to be running iOS 9 or later on the iPhone, iPad, or iPod touch. Earlier versions do not have the Trash All Mail feature and would need to go with a different approach.
